2009-A2927 (ACTIVE) - Summary

Creates the concentrated animal feeding operation board to study nutrient management and exchange, and to collect and study data on nutrient management systems on certain farms in the state.

  Section 1. The agriculture and markets law is amended by adding a  new
article 26-C to read as follows:
                              ARTICLE 26-C
               CONCENTRATED ANIMAL FEEDING OPERATION BOARD
SECTION 420. CONCENTRATED ANIMAL FEEDING OPERATION BOARD.
  S 420. CONCENTRATED ANIMAL FEEDING OPERATION BOARD. 1. THERE IS HEREBY
CREATED THE CONCENTRATED ANIMAL FEEDING OPERATION BOARD. THE BOARD SHALL
CONSIST OF SEVEN MEMBERS. THE MEMBERS OF THE BOARD SHALL BE APPOINTED BY
THE  COMMISSIONER AS FOLLOWS: ONE UPON THE RECOMMENDATION OF THE COMMIS-
SIONER OF ENVIRONMENTAL CONSERVATION, ONE UPON THE RECOMMENDATION OF THE
DEAN OF THE CORNELL UNIVERSITY SCHOOL OF AGRICULTURE AND LIFE  SCIENCES,
AND  FIVE  MEMBERS SHALL BE PRIVATE STAKEHOLDERS REPRESENTING THE INTER-
ESTS OF CONCENTRATED ANIMAL FEEDING  OPERATION  REGULATED  FARM  OWNERS,
NUTRIENT MANAGEMENT PLANNERS OR SPECIALISTS, AND MEMBERS OF THE ENVIRON-
MENTAL  COMMUNITY. A CHAIR AND VICE-CHAIR OF SUCH BOARD SHALL BE ELECTED
BY A MAJORITY VOTE OF THE  MEMBERS.  THE  MEMBERS  OF  THE  BOARD  SHALL
RECEIVE  NO  COMPENSATION  FOR  THEIR  SERVICES  AS MEMBERS BUT SHALL BE
ALLOWED THEIR ACTUAL AND NECESSARY EXPENSES  INCURRED  BY  THEM  IN  THE
PERFORMANCE OF THEIR DUTIES PURSUANT TO THIS ARTICLE.
